Easy Trip Planners Ltd Technical Momentum Shifts Amid Mixed Market Signals
Easy Trip Planners Ltd has exhibited a subtle shift in price momentum, transitioning from a sideways trend to a mildly bullish stance, despite a complex technical backdrop. While daily moving averages signal modest optimism, longer-term indicators such as MACD and Bollinger Bands remain bearish, reflecting ongoing challenges for this small-cap player in the tour and travel services sector.

Easy Trip Planners Ltd Downgraded to Strong Sell Amid Weak Financials and Technicals
Easy Trip Planners Ltd has been downgraded from a Sell to a Strong Sell rating as of 3 July 2026, reflecting deteriorating fundamentals across quality, valuation, financial trends, and technical indicators. The company’s ongoing financial struggles, coupled with bearish technical signals, have prompted a reassessment of its investment appeal within the tour and travel services sector.
